Beware! Fake Laptop Power Banks Flooding Nigerian Market

A new warning is spreading through the Nigerian market, as copyright laptop power banks flood the shelves. These fraudulent devices are being sold at low prices, but they pose a serious hazard to your laptop and even your health. Users need to be cautious when purchasing power banks to avoid falling victim to these criminals.

Here are some guidelines to help you spot a fake power bank:

* Look for the box for any mistakes in spelling, grammar, or branding.

* Inspect the power bank itself for substandard materials and construction.

* Compare the price to original power banks from reputable companies. If it seems too good to be true, it probably is.

Remember, your safety and the longevity of your laptop are worth investing in a genuine power bank.
